Radial Transport of Io Plasma From the Inner Magnetosphere to the Tail

Published in Journal of Geophysical Research: Space Physics, 2023

  • Around 10–15 Rj in the equatorial plane, precession effect overwhelms interchange for the outward transport of Io plasma

  • Io plasma is interchange unstable around 15–20 Rj and here diffuses outward while being mixed with H+ from the ionosphere

  • The equatorial diffuse emission is projected with the low-speed polar wind to the outer shell of the Io torus around 15–20 Rj in the equatorial plane
